The National Weather Service in New Orleans has forecasted a week that stands as a testament to the city's humid subtropical climate, with mostly sunny skies punctuated by occasional chances of showers and thunderstorms, particularly in the afternoons.

Residents can anticipate a warm Sunday with highs hovering around 90 degrees, and a light breeze making a shy appearance in the afternoon it's a mild respite from the otherwise still air that tends to define the Crescent City's weather. The calm is set to continue into the evening with an expected low of 74 degrees and a southeast wind settling down as night falls, as per the National Weather Service forecast.

Tending towards predictability but never quite fully predictable, the pattern for the following days carries on much in the same vein - sunny mornings giving way to a 20 percent chance of afternoon showers and thunderstorms from Monday to Tuesday. With the thermometer consistently tipping near the 90-degree mark, one might find solace in the embrace of shade or the relief provided by air-conditioned refuges.

Come Wednesday the week takes on a slightly unsettled character, the chance for scattered showers and possible thunderstorms creeping up under mostly sunny skies that betray little of the instability brewing in the heavens; such is the dance of atmospheric dynamics over New Orleans. Light winds will start from the south before a subtle turn to the southwest brings in the day's high of around 90 degrees.

As Thursday approaches, the forecasts suggest a continuing saga of sun and sporadic rain, the city bathed in sunlight till the afternoon when thunderstorms might punctuate the skyline with their rumbling commentary which this rhythm, though intermittent, is part of the heartbeat of this vibrant city.
